The unemployment rate in Chillicothe township, MO, is 8.70%, with job growth of -0.76%.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 29.78%.

Chillicothe township, MO Taxes

Chillicothe township, MO,sales tax rate is 7.23%. Income tax is 6.00%.

Chillicothe township, MO Income and Salaries

The income per capita is $20,810, which includes all adults and children. The median household income is $39,007.
